Job Description We are seeking a Hardware Project Engineer to join our team onsite. The ideal candidate will have strong experience in electronic systems, PCBA and embedded systems, and requirements management and a proven ability to deliver space electronics from development through production with verified performance, reliability, and manufacturability. Responsibilities: Support the responsible engineer in development and production of custom space electronics; support senior lead on complex projects. Manage and review product requirements with internal and external stakeholders across the development lifecycle. Derive design and test requirements to meet performance, functionality, reliability, and manufacturability objectives. Collaborate with designers to validate concepts through trade studies and analyses. Allocate requirements to functional disciplines and coordinate verification activities to closure with documentation. Author and review engineering analyses and reports; ensure data deliverables meet specifications and schedules. Author test procedures; assist in design verification and production hardware testing. Read and interpret PCBA schematics; use lab equipment to diagnose and troubleshoot to component and IC level. Resolve nonconformances during manufacturing and test, lead FRB meetings, and drive RCCA activities. Serve as primary point of contact during 24/7 product testing campaigns as required. Required Skills & Qualifications: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ering. 3+ years of experience in electronic systems with at least one of: PCBA design, embedded processor software design, or requirements management. Proven experience authoring, managing, deriving, and verifying requirements for complex electronics. Direct user experience with a requirements management tool such as IBM Rational DOORS, JAMA Connect, or Siemens Polarion preferred.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Project. Ability to work independently with project ownership and proactive problem solving. Strong understanding of computer architecture and digital interface technologies. Onsite availability with flexibility to support continuous test operations as needed. Preferred Skills: Experience specifying or designing space-based, radiation-hardened electronic components.
